(Solved) – Problem with GetSharedDefaultFolder in VBA


I want to code a macro that checks appointments in shared calendards of my coworkers.

Here’s is my code:

        Set oCalendar = Application.Session.GetSharedDefaultFolder(MyRecipient, olFolderCalendar)
        Set oItems = oCalendar.Items

However, this works only for collegues which shared their calendars with ALL details, I cannot check calendars of colleagues that only shared start/end, topic of the meeting, room (most common method).

Is there a command similar to GetSharedDefaultFolder or do I have to adjust something in this code?

Thanks and best regards,


Leave a Reply

Your email address will not be published. Required fields are marked *